Tracking the pre-service teachers' development of communicative skills and their beliefs towards communicative approach
Concerns about the purpose of developing communicative skills in English teaching and approaches to overcome these concerns have always had an important place in language teaching. In this context, besides the fact that teachers' roles are important, their beliefs about the approach have a prof...
